Literature summary extracted from

  • Taoka, S.; Widjaja, L.; Banerjee, R.
    Assignment of enzymatic functions to specific regions of the PLP-dependent heme protein cystathionine beta-synthase (1999), Biochemistry, 38, 13155-13161.
    View publication on PubMed

Activating Compound

EC Number Activating Compound Comment Organism Structure
4.2.1.22 S-adenosyl-L-methionine activates full length enzyme, but not the truncated core, 4 S-adenosyl-L-methionine molecules per tetramer Homo sapiens

Protein Variants

EC Number Protein Variants Comment Organism
4.2.1.22 additional information CBSdeltaC143, truncated catalytic core in which the C-terminal 143 amino acid residues are deleted, higher Km for the substrates Homo sapiens
